In general, schools, public health centers, hospitals, etc. collect stools of students or subjects for periodic or occasional stool tests.

In the past, most of the stools were collected by using cotton swabs or wooden chopsticks instead of using a special tabletop device. However, recently, a public health center or a hospital provides a tabletop device for the purpose of user convenience and hygiene management. And collecting and collecting feces.

In addition, the above-mentioned tabletting apparatus is provided from a public health center or a hospital or the like, and the collected sample is collected at home and sent to the relevant inspection agency by mail.

As shown in Fig. 1, a conventional wetting device includes a fillet container 2 for accommodating collected feces, a lid 3 for covering the fillet container, and a lid 3, which protrudes from the inner surface of the lid 3 And a collecting unit 4 formed as a plate-shaped piece to collect faeces.

The conventional companion tool 1 is a sample collector for collecting the feces required for the inspection in the collection section 4 and collecting the sample in the flesh container 2 in a solid state. The collected feces sample is collected through the reagent It is used to store and store the stool sample until it is buried on the inspection bar on the side of the inspection container that performs the inspection step.

However, the conventional companion tool 1 having the above-described configuration is disadvantageous in that the compulsive container 2 has a cylindrical body and is inconvenient for attaching and preparing a label for recording personal information (name, date of birth, sex, etc.) It is also inconvenient to send mail, and it has an inadequate form. Therefore, the person to be inspected must visit the inspection agency (public health center, hospital, etc.) and receive it.

In addition, since the entire body of the conventional companion tool 1 is formed to be opaque, it is not easy to check the contents in the process of taking over and taking over, and there is an inconvenience to open the lid 3 one by one in order to check the contents, The length of the lid 3 is too short when the lid 3 is used to use the part 4 and it is inconvenient to hold the lid 3 by hand and there is a case that the feces is applied to the hand during the sampling of the feces.

Furthermore, since the collecting part 4 is formed in a simple plate-like structure in the conventional companion tool 1, it is difficult to collect a sample of the same in a predetermined amount, and a part for collecting the sample (collection part 4) (Collecting container 2) is divided, a collecting part 4 having a plate-like piece shape is scratched and collected in the collecting container 2 in the process of opening the lid 3 for checking and inspecting the contents A phenomenon of causing a flicker phenomenon or spilling out is often occurring.

In addition, since the conventional filler device 1 is divided into a portion for collecting the feces sample (collecting portion 4) and a portion for collecting the collected sample (collecting container 2), the feces sample contained in the feces container 2 is sent by mail There is a case where the sample is easily moved due to the movement generated during the transfer and therefore the sample is buried in the lid 3 rather than the tampering container 2. This makes it inconvenient for the inspector to confirm the location of the sample in the stool every time, There is a problem that can not be achieved.

As shown in FIGS. 2 to 4, the fecal sample collecting apparatus 100 according to the embodiment of the present invention includes a sample collecting receiving unit 110 for collecting and accommodating a feces sample therein, And a cap unit 120 for performing the operation.

The sample collecting receptacle 110 is provided with a handle 112 for providing ease of coupling with and attachment to the cap 120.

At this time, the handle 112 is formed at its end with a coupling part for fitting with the cap part 120, and may have a stepped structure as shown in the figure.

Preferably, the handle 112 is formed as a body having a shape corresponding to that of the cap 120, so that the handle 112 can be easily engaged with each other.

The handle 112 is preferably a rectangular body for ease of mounting. It is preferable that the handle 112 is formed so as to have a flat plane on two or more sides of the body in the front-back direction or the left-right direction in consideration of design and the like.

As shown in the drawing, the handle 112 is an elliptical body and can be configured to have a plane on both sides.

The handle 112 is preferably configured to have a length of 1.5 to 2.5 cm in consideration of the size, design, and economical efficiency of the product, in addition to stably holding the handle 112 with the fingers.

The sample collecting receptacle 114 is formed as a tubular body having a predetermined length and extending in one end of the handle 112 to be integrally formed and protruded.

The sample collecting receptacle 114 preferably has a length corresponding to a range of 4 to 5 cm in consideration of the size and design of the whole product as well as a sample of a suitable stool sample.

By forming the sample collecting receptacle 114 as a tubular body, it is possible to provide an advantage that the sample can be immediately taken in and collected at the same time as the sample is collected, a certain amount of the sample of the feces can be advantageously collected, So that the user convenience can be improved.

In addition, through the structural design of the tubular body, a bar-type bar (a test rod) of a fillet rod or the like at the time of a fecal test performed after collecting a feces sample using the fecal sample sampler 100 of the present invention The present invention provides a structure capable of internal insertion, and can be used more conveniently than a conventional method of burial, thereby enhancing the convenience of a tester.

The end of the tubular body is sharpened in the form of a needle, and the tubular body is slit-shaped by some incisions toward the handle 112 from the end of the tubular body. (Opening) 114a are formed in the opening 114a.

The slit-shaped opening 114a may be formed by forming the slit-shaped opening 114a in the form of a sharp needle-like shape, thereby facilitating insertion into the feces for sampling, It is possible to smoothly induce the inside of the fecal sample to be collected and to collect a certain amount of the fecal sample by providing the groove structure rather than the hole structure with respect to the sample collecting receptacle 114 through the formation of the hole.

That is, the sample collecting receptacle 114 having the above-described configuration is formed by integrally forming a portion for collecting the feces sample and a portion for accommodating the collected feces sample, It has a structure that can be carried out together, and enables a more hygienic treatment than the existing one.

In addition, the conventional faecal sample collectors including the conventional companion tool as shown in FIG. 1 are all equipped with a portion for collecting a feces sample (a fillet rod) and a portion for storing and storing the collected faecal sample (collecting container) This design differs in terms of technical composition and function.

Further, although not shown, the sample collecting receptacle 114 has a concave-convex structure such as a plurality of embossing protrusions or grid pattern irregularities on the inner surface of the tubular body, so that the feces sample accommodated in the tubular body is easily removed from the sample collecting receptacle 114 It can be configured so as to be prevented from flowing out.

The cap unit 120 includes a body 112 having a shape corresponding to that of the handle 112 and includes a sample collecting receptacle 114 protruding from the end of the handle 112 for accommodating therein the sample collecting receptacle 114, It is preferable to use a rectangular body having a flat surface for easy attachment and preparation of a label for recording information of a person to be inspected.

The cap part 120 is formed as a body having a shape corresponding to each other so that the cap part 120 can be engaged with the handle 112. The cap part 120 is preferably formed to have a flat surface in two or more faces such as a front-back direction or a left-right direction.

As shown in the figure, the cap part 120 may be an elliptical body, and may have a planar shape on both sides.

The cap portion 120 may be formed of a transparent body so that the content of the feces sample contained in the sample collecting receptacle 114 can be easily confirmed from the outside. The transparent portion may be formed of a transparent synthetic resin material such as acrylic or silicone .

The stool sampler 100 according to the present invention constructed in this manner is designed in a square plane structure to which a round is applied for designing. The stool sampler 100 has a slender body having an outer shape of a substantially rectangular tube shape, 100) can be put in a mail envelope to facilitate postal dispatch processing.
